REDDISH v. SMITH

No. 63950.

468 So.2d 929 (1985)

J.R. REDDISH and the Department of Corrections of the State of Florida, Petitioners, v. Charles W. SMITH and Emma L. Smith, His Wife, Respondents.

Supreme Court of Florida.

April 4, 1985.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Richard L. Randle of Slater and Randle, Jacksonville, for petitioners.

Kenneth Vickers of Vickers and Rohan, Jacksonville, for respondents.

Jim Smith, Atty. Gen., and Miguel A. Olivella, Asst. Atty. Gen., Tallahassee, amius curiae for Atty. Gen. of The State of Florida.

Barry Richard of Roberts, Baggett, LaFace, Richard and Wiser, Tallahassee, amius curiae for James M. Johnson.


BOYD, Chief Justice.

This cause is before the Court on petition for review of a decision of the First District Court of Appeal reversing the dismissal of the respondents' complaint against a state agency and a state employee.
